There should be another option, referred to as "Advanced.. something", you'll select this option and then configure the endpoint via the web interface. Since you don't have any video conference infrastructure, you'll have to configure the endpoint as a standalone system, take a look at Vivek's reply here on what do: sx20-as-standalone. Once you get H323 configured, you can then call via IP address to each endpoint.
